Output 684d5dfeebde1ca0ff9c51ab9da5c1b25cbd945437e10323d63ed0519cb56a56:1

value
17219274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de4be72e282e1589d97ec3c24ea91dc8ab71d76 OP_EQUAL
address
3EdHDzvSA5jHYetX6US9uZDDWHWm7vVemp
transaction
684d5dfeebde1ca0ff9c51ab9da5c1b25cbd945437e10323d63ed0519cb56a56
spent
true